Chap fan or mixed rice is also referred to as economy rice as it is cheap and you get a variety of food.

However, it seems that economy rice may not be the correct term any longer as a netizen has shared that getting 1 meat and 1 vegetable has cost them RM28!

According to both Sin Chew Daily and China Press, a Facebook user has shared their experience of taking out mixed rice from a restaurant in Kinrara, Puchong.

After putting in the rice, 1 vegetable dish and 1 pork dish into his lunch box, the total came up to a whopping RM28!

Economy Rice Rm28

As it would not be hygienic to put back whatever he took, he paid for the food and went home.

In the post, he says that this store is just a regular restaurant, but the price is like buying from Pavillion food court.

He laments: “Is this (the high price) because I took too much pork?” but he admits that he is at fault as well, as he did not ask for the price first.

“The restaurant did not put the price out so I just took it. As a result, I ended up eating expensive mixed rice and I only have myself to blame.”

Many netizens were saying that the portion of meat is quite hefty. However, it should not have cost more than RM20.
